Leaving the tarmac road one follows an unpaved road and heads to the Manor House gate.
Surrounded by a 7.6 ha land inside a stone wall over 3 mts high with a representative vaulted gate, is the Manor House with 250 m2. It boosts a perfectly preserved beautiful baroque décor. An imponente Hall with high ceilings gives access to the Lounge on the right and a Living room on the left, both decorated with wood burning traditional tile stoves. It has 5 bedrooms, a Library and a Chapel.
In the garden there are two richly decorated baroque swimming pools, a fountain, a Roman Cistern, a one bedroom full equipped gardener’s house, stables, sheepfolds and other buildings.
The property is located at the foot of the extremely picturesque and nature reserve Serra de Sao Mamede mountains and the diversity of species in the region is amazing allowing activities like hunting and bird watching.
